The two-block stretch of Roxbury Drive in Beverly Hills between Sunset Boulevard and Benedict Canyon was once home to the biggest names in show business. Lucille Ball, James Stewart, Jack Benny, Agnes Moorehead, Ira Gershwin, Peter Falk, Rosemary Clooney, and the list went on and on. In more recent decades, Diane Keaton called the street home, and she later sold her house to Madonna.

The big-name roster of Roxbury Drive isn’t quite the same as it once was, but the echo of its past remains in the varying architecture of the houses that have survived. Now another one of those historic homes is in danger.

“That street was just so iconic,” said Alison Martino, curator of Vintage Los Angeles whose father was singer Al Martino.

The residence at 1001 Roxbury Drive is a home that Martino said most encapsulates the area. Built in 1942 by architect Carlton L. Burgess, the more than 9,000 square foot regency revival structure sits back from the street and has a brick driveway, sidewalk and sprawling lawn on a double lot. While a name the stature of Ball or Stewart are not known to have owned the house, Martino said it could have once been the home of Walter Winchell. The property has been renovated on several occasions, including once by John Elgin Woolf. A restoration by Mark Rios won a Will Rogers award in 2015.

“It’s always been everyone’s favorite house who lives in Beverly Hills and who comes to Beverly Hills,” Martino said. “When those tour buses go up and down Roxbury, that is a house that is pointed out. Even though it hasn’t been owned by a notable celebrity, it’s not about who lived there. It’s the architecture and the stunning grounds.”

“[It is] a legacy of Beverly Hills architecture from a time of refinement before the hulking beasts of value by maximum square footage swept the city,” Leslie Barrett said in a comment on the Vintage Los Angeles Facebook page. “It’s a gorgeous house and a tragedy that the new owner is wasting something dear.”

Eric Baker purchased the property in 2020 for over $39 million. The Beverly Hills native co-founded StubHub, the online ticketing giant, in 2000. He has long been based in London, founding another similar company there, Viagogo, which later purchased StubHub. Baker already has a significant footprint in Beverly Hills real estate. He owns two other properties in the flats, one of which was listed on the market not long after he purchased the home on Roxbury Drive. His parents also reside in the city.

Baker does not intend to keep the 1001 Roxbury Drive intact, however, Martino said.

“Nobody knows what he wants to build in its place,” she added. “He has applied and been granted a certificate of ineligibility, so he can do with it what he wants.”

The certificate of ineligibility deems that a structure is historically insignificant and can be demolished.

Martino said that Beverly Hills director of community development Ryan Gohlich found that that the building did not meet the city’s definition of exceptional work by a contractor or master architect.

To qualify for protection, the home would have had to have been featured in architectural magazines or been granted awards for its design, not just for one of its renovations. The age, character or the feelings the community might have for it do not constitute preservation.

The property’s fate was debated into the early hours of the morning at the April 12 Beverly Hills City Council meeting, with community members like David Silvas, a real estate agent specializing in historic properties in Beverly Hills, speaking in support of preserving the home.

“This would be a grave mistake not to declare this property historically eligible in this community,” Silvas said. “Beverly Hills has an unfortunate track record in the preservation world of being a city that is difficult to deal with … We are giving up the history [and] the cultural context of the fabric of this community. And there’s not enough golden shields that can be manufactured to replace everything that will erode away if this keeps up.”

Similar fates have come to other homes on Roxbury Drive over the years, including the homes occupied by James Stewart and Rosemary Clooney. While Lucille Ball’s house still sits on the same frame, the façade itself has been altered.

Resident George Milstein spoke in favor of Baker’s right to demolish the property.

“This property owner, in fact, has done everything that [they have asked] them to do and requires them to do and the certificate as issued by staff should stand,” Milstein said.

The majority of speakers, however, urged the council to reconsider the home’s historical status.

“Beverly Hills does a very poor job of historic preservation,” Jill Collins, of the Beverly Hills Cultural Heritage Commission, said. “Just think about what has been lost in recent years and the crap that has been built in its place. This is my dream house. Sometimes I drive by it and just park that imagine what it’s like inside. Seriously, this is breaking my heart. I just don’t understand what’s wrong with people. This house is part of the indelible landscape of Beverly Hills. Not just the history but the structure itself.”

“It’s a historic gem. It tells the fabric of the city. And they’re never going to be able to build anything like that ever again,” Martino said.

No final decision on the house’s fate was made at the meeting, but the City Council decided to reconsider granting the right for it to be demolished. Martino said it gave her hope that community support may help save the house.

“This is like ‘It’s a Wonderful Life,’ and we’re all trying to be George Bailey,” she added.
